Read Write Think: Research Building Blocks: Notes, Quotes, and Fact Fragments

Curated by ACT

Contains plans for a lesson on taking notes that is part of a larger unit on researching a state symbol. It works on skills like figuring out what information is relevant and irrelevant, using a variety of sources, and paraphrasing. In addition to objectives and standards, this instructional plan contains links to sites used in the lessons as well as assessment and reflection activities.
